Wealthy pensioners are being asked to help the needy by donating their winter fuel allowance to Rotary clubs.
The Rotary Club of Maidenhead (RCM) is asking for some over-65s to give up their once-a-year £100 payment to be redistributed to charity.
The fuel allowance, which is not means tested, is handed to everyone claiming an old age pension regardless of their affluence.
Those who donate would be able to specify in a note whether they would like the money to stay in UK or go abroad.
